Viewing and Printing Registry Data as Text

You might want to examine the contents of a Registry key as text for troubleshooting. You can save a key as a text file, and you can print data from Registry Editor, including a key, its subkeys, and all of the value entries of all of its subkeys.

The Save Subtree As command also works for the H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\HARDWARE subtree, which you cannot otherwise save as a hive file.
